Ricky Pearsall will have to wait a while before returning to the NFL field.
The San Francisco 49ers wide receiver underwent surgery on his right knee and will now begin a rehabilitation process that could last nearly nine months.
The 25-year-old Pearsall quickly checked in with fans after his surgery. Just a few hours after leaving the operating room, he posted a photo on Instagram showing him in the hospital with family members. Despite the long recovery period ahead of him, the player maintains a resolutely positive attitude.
Pearsall knows, however, that the road back to football will be challenging. In his post, he explains that he plans to focus particularly on his mental, physical, and spiritual preparation. He also intends to make the most of every stage of his recovery, including the tougher days and the small, often-overlooked steps of progress.
This knee injury is not new. The wide receiver initially suffered the injury during Week 4 of last season, in a game against the Jacksonville Jaguars. At that time, Pearsall and the California-based organization had hoped to avoid surgery and opt for rest instead.
An Absence That Changes the 49ers' Plans
However, the situation changed during training camp. After just three practices, Pearsall once again experienced issues with the same knee. Discussions about surgery resumed, and the final decision was to proceed with the procedure.
This decision means Pearsall will have to sit out the upcoming season. If he stays on schedule, he could make his return in 2027, as he begins what is expected to be the fourth year of his contract.
Since the start of his NFL career, Pearsall has played in 20 games. So far, he has accumulated 928 receiving yards and three touchdowns. His absence therefore presents an additional challenge for the 49ers, who will have to make do without one of their wide receivers.
For now, Pearsall's main goal is clear: to take the time needed to make a full recovery and, one step at a time, work his way back onto the football field.
